The Boat Division Personal Property Custodian Level III is responsible for the accountability, management, inventory, and lifecycle control of government property assigned to Boat Division. This position manages capital assets, minor property, and operational consumables ensuring accurate records, timely reporting, and compliance with applicable property accountability requirements.
Responsibilities
- Process requests for the issue, turn-in, gain, transfer, and loss of capital assets, minor property, and operational consumables assigned to Boat Division.
- Maintain accurate property accountability and inventory records in SWALIS, DPAS, and other authorized systems.
- Conduct monthly, bi-annual, and annual inventories of gear managed in SWALIS/DPAS.
- Investigate missing, lost, stolen, or damaged property and process all required supporting paperwork.
- Generate and submit weekly and monthly reports to Command Leadership.
- Obtain vendor quotes and submit purchase requests for operational parts and supplies.
- Maintain documentation supporting inspections, audits, and property accountability reviews.
- Operate forklifts, government vehicles, and Civil Engineer Support Equipment (CESE), as authorized, in support of official duties.
- Perform related logistics and property accountability duties as assigned.
